Job Summary

A heavy equipment operator operates a variety of heavy equipment used in construction, maintenance and repair activities and performs a variety of tasks in the construction and maintenance of heavy civil work like trenching, excavation, grading, bulldozing and paving.

Typical Duties

  • Operates heavy equipment of various sizes and weights in the loading, hauling and unloading of various equipment, materials and supplies.
  • Operates heavy equipment such as backhoe, road grader, front-end loader, hydraulic excavator, skid steers loader, bulldozer, roller, compactor and crane.
  • Assists crew in digging ditches and trenches, hoisting materials and tools, equipment and any related work with a backhoe, excavator, front-end loader or crane.
  • Performs routine inspection of equipment and notifies supervisor of defects or repairs that need to be made.
  • Performs all duties in conformance to appropriate safety and security standards and specifications.

Activities:

Perform General Physical Activities: perform general physical activities that require considerable use of your arms, legs and moving whole body such as climbing, lifting, balancing, walking, stooping and handling materials.

Handling and Moving Objects: using hands and arms in handling, installing positioning materials and manipulating things.

Controlling Machines and Processes: use either control mechanisms or direct physical activity to operate machines or processes.

Monitor Progress, Materials or Surroundings: monitoring and reviewing information from materials events or the environment, to detect or assess problems.

Using and Maintaining Mechanical Equipment: adjust and test machines, devices, moving parts and equipment that operate primarily based on mechanical (not electrical principals).  Determine when equipment and tools are not functioning properly and need replacement or repair.
